Explanation:

If 156 degrees is the interior angle measure, then 180-156 = 24 is the exterior angle measure.

Divide 360 over this to find that 360/24 = 15

This means the regular polygon has 15 sides.

I'm using the idea that if n is the number of sides, then 360/n is the exterior angle measure. So 180 - (360/n) is the interior measure.

Write and solve an inequality that represents the number of days driven without the warning light coming on. Explain clearly what the solution to the inequality means in the context of this situation.

Answers

Answer:

0.6x < 12.5

x < 20.83 days

Step-by-step explanation:

Diego's family car holds 14 gallons of fuel. Each day the car uses 0.6 gallons of fuel. A warning light comes on when the remaining fuel is 1.5 gallons or less. Write an inequality that represents the number of days Diego's father can drive the car without the warning light coming on. Explain each part of your inequality

Car fuel capacity = 14 gallons

Fuel capacity that shows warning light = 1.5 gallons

Fuel capacity without warning light = Car fuel capacity - Fuel capacity that shows warning light

= 14 gallons - 1.5 gallons

= 12.5 gallons

Fuel used per day = 0.6 gallons

Let

x = number of days Diego's father can drive the car without the warning light coming on

The inequality is

0.6x < 12.5

Solve for x

x < 12.5/0.6

x < 20.83 days
